Keihin CR Specials and Mikuni RS Smoothbores are some of the best you can buy. They have better throttle response but also require more controlled throttle input from the rider, much different than CV carbs. Probably a waste of money on a stock motor.

Not cheap. New are over $500. Used sell for for $300 and up.

I sold one set of CR specials for $275. I lucked out and scored another set for $100.
